Address

3PXw79v8nigjg1dFaCFbfkxq3JZC8sXBkM
Confirmed tx count
357
Confirmed received
180 outputs (1226.04213828 BTC)
Confirmed spent
178 outputs (1226.04202940 BTC)
Confirmed unspent
2 outputs (0.00010888 BTC)

25 of 357 Transactions